If you're choosing a payment gateway for an Indian business in 2026, the best option depends on your business model rather than a single "winner." Here's a practical comparison: | Payment Gateway | Best For | Strengths | Potential Drawbacks | |---|---|---|---| | Razorpay | Startups, SaaS, D2C | Excellent APIs, subscriptions, payment links, strong documentation, payouts | Support can vary during peak periods | | Cashfree Payments | High-volume businesses, marketplaces | Fast settlements, bulk payouts, international expansion, developer-friendly APIs | Dashboard can feel more technical | | PhonePe Payment Gateway | UPI-heavy merchants | Strong UPI performance, competitive pricing, easy onboarding | Smaller ecosystem than some competitors | | PayU | Growing businesses | Mature platform, recurring billing, fraud tools | Integration experience varies by use case | | CCAvenue | Businesses needing many payment methods | Long track record, extensive payment options, international support | Older interface compared with newer platforms | ### Recommendations by business type - **New startup or SaaS:** Razorpay - **Marketplace with vendor payouts:** Cashfree Payments - **E-commerce store focused on Indian customers:** PhonePe Payment Gateway or Razorpay - **Enterprise with high transaction volume:** Cashfree Payments or PayU - **International customers:** CCAvenue or Cashfree Payments ### Key features to evaluate Don't compare gateways on transaction fees alone. Also consider: - Payment success rate (especially UPI) - Settlement speed (T+0, T+1, etc.) - Subscription and recurring payment support - Refund and dispute management - Payout APIs - International payment acceptance - Checkout performance on mobile - Developer documentation and SDK quality - Customer support responsiveness ### My overall ranking for 2026 1. Razorpay — Best overall for most businesses 2. Cashfree Payments — Best for scale, payouts, and APIs 3. PhonePe Payment Gateway — Best for UPI-first businesses 4. PayU — Strong enterprise option 5. CCAvenue — Best for businesses requiring extensive payment method coverage Industry comparisons in 2026 consistently place these providers among the leading options for Indian merchants, with increasing emphasis on UPI reliability, fast settlements, and developer experience. Choosing the right payment gateway in India depends entirely on your business model, development resources, and target audience. For a standard domestic setup, the industry average transaction fee (MDR) hovers around **2% + GST** (with 0% for UPI and RuPay debit cards). The top Indian payment gateways are categorized below by business fit to help you choose the best option. --- ## 1. The Best All-Rounders (Startups & D2C Brands) ### Razorpay Razorpay remains the market leader for tech-first businesses, startups, and modern D2C brands due to its slick UI and developer-friendly documentation. * **Best For:** Fast integration, Shopify/WooCommerce stores, and hybrid online+offline setups. * **Standout Feature:** AI-driven tools (like automated chargeback defense and instant UTR reconciliation) and vernacular checkout voice support. * **Fees:** ~2% + GST per domestic transaction; T+2 days settlement cycle. ### Cashfree Payments Cashfree has emerged as a powerhouse alternative to Razorpay, specifically praised for its aggressive pricing and high success rates. * **Best For:** High-volume e-commerce, automated payouts, and multi-vendor marketplaces. * **Standout Feature:** Incredible instant refund processing capabilities and a competitive flat **1.6% MDR** for eligible businesses. * **Fees:** ~1.6% to 1.95% + GST; T+1 days settlement cycle. --- ## 2. Best for Creators, Micro-Merchants & No-Code Sellers ### Instamojo If you don't have a fully functional website or technical knowledge and just want to sell digital goods, services, or physical products via social media, Instamojo is a strong fit. * **Best For:** Freelancers, independent creators, and micro-merchants. * **Standout Feature:** Seamless, instant payment links that you can generate and share on WhatsApp or Instagram with zero coding. * **Fees:** Slightly higher (~2% to 5% + ₹3 per transaction); T+1 to T+3 days settlement. *Note: Limited international payment support.* --- ## 3. Best for Mobile-First & Hyper-Local Consumers ### PhonePe Payment Gateway With nearly 1 in 3 Indians using the PhonePe consumer app, their dedicated business payment gateway leverages massive brand familiarity. * **Best For:** App-heavy businesses and local mobile commerce. * **Standout Feature:** Near-perfect success rates for UPI transactions, and the ability to push custom loyalty coupons directly to users. * **Fees:** Highly competitive/custom pricing; T+1 days settlement. --- ## 4. Best for Cross-Border & Global SaaS ### Stripe India If you are running a SaaS business, selling digital subscriptions internationally, or targeting an overseas audience, Stripe is the global gold standard. * **Best For:** International sales and recurring subscription models. * **Standout Feature:** World-class recurring billing engine and extensive global multi-currency coverage. * **Fees:** 2% onwards (significantly higher for international cards, often ~4.4%); T+2 to T+7 days settlement. --- ## 5. Best for Large Enterprises & Legacy Systems ### PayU India or CCAvenue These are the veteran heavyweights of the Indian fintech ecosystem, built to handle massive transactional scale and deep institutional requirements. * **Best For:** Government portals, large enterprise marketplaces, utility companies, and high-ticket B2B transactions. * **Standout Feature:** Massive bank routing network. If one banking server goes down, their backend intelligently re-routes the traffic instantly to minimize downtime. * **Fees:** Custom enterprise pricing; T+1 to T+2 days settlement. --- ### Summary Recommendation * Choose **Razorpay** if you want the easiest dashboard and plugin setup for an e-commerce site. * Choose **Cashfree** if you want the lowest transactional margins and faster settlement. * Choose **Stripe** if your main focus is charging international clients in USD or setting up recurring subscriptions. Based on the 2026 payment landscape in India, selecting the best payment gateway depends on your specific business needs, such as high UPI success rates, international support, or easy integration. The top contenders this year include established players and innovative newcomers. Here are top recommendations for 2026: - **:** Known for its massive user base and exceptional UPI success rates. It is ideal if your customers primarily pay via UPI and you need reliable, real-time transaction routing. - **PayU Payment Gateway:** A strong contender for large-scale e-commerce, offering 150+ payment methods, including robust credit card support, net banking, and international payments. It excels in providing a seamless checkout experience. - **:** Still a top choice for small and medium enterprises (SMEs) due to its quick onboarding and easy integration. - **:** Known for its advanced features like instant settlements and wide support for different payment modes. - **:** A recommended alternative for global companies looking to operate in India. **Factors to Consider for 2026:** - **UPI Reliability:** With UPI driving the market, choose a gateway with advanced "instrument health tracking" to prevent failures. - **Settlement Speed:** Look for gateways that offer same-day or instant settlement options. - **Developer-Friendly:** Evaluate APIs for smooth integration (e.g., PhonePe, Razorpay). For the best choice, consider your specific transaction volume and the type of payment methods (UPI vs. Cards) your customers use most frequently.
